NEW YORK – UConn graduate student guard Azzi Fudd averaged 27.5 points on a .581/.688/1.000 shooting split in another 2-0 week to be named the BIG EAST Player of the Week. Teammate freshman forward Blanca Quiñonez averaged 11.5 points for the Huskies to claim freshman of the week for the second straight week.
Marquette junior guard Halle Vice, Providence graduate student guard Sabou Gueye, Seton Hall junior guard Savannah Catalon, Villanova senior guard Ryanne Allen, and Xavier junior guard Mariyah Noel were named to this week's honor roll.
BIG EAST Player of the Week
Azzi Fudd, UConn, Gr., G
Fudd averaged 27.5 points on a .581/.688/1.000 shooting split in wins over #6 Michigan and Utah. She scored a season-high 31 points and went 7-for-12 from three-point range with five rebounds in the 72-69 victory against the Wolverines. As Michigan made a comeback, Fudd scored 13 points in the fourth quarter to hold off the Wolverines, including going 3-for-3 from three. In the 93-41 win over Utah, Fudd shot 9-for-11 and went 4-for-4 from three for 24 points. She added a career-high eight rebounds.
BIG EAST Freshman of the Week
Blanca Quiñonez, UConn, Fr., F
Quiñonez averaged 11.5 points in UConn's 2-0 week. The freshman scored a season-high 21 points on 8-for-11 shooting and grabbed five boards in the 93-41 route versus Utah.
BIG EAST Weekly Honor Roll
Halle Vice, Marquette, Jr., G
Vice scored a career-high 23 points to pace Marquette to a 75-43 win over Milwaukee. She shot an efficient 9-of-11 from the field and was 3-of-4 from beyond the arc.
Sabou Gueye, Providence, Gr., G
Gueye averaged 21.5 points per game in wins over Northeastern and Yale for the Friars. She shot .621 from the field (18-29) and .778 from the foul line and added 5.5 rebounds, 2.5 assists, and 3.0 steals per game. Gueye scored 20+ points in each of the Friars' games last week, including a career-high 22 points against Yale.
Savannah Catalon, Seton Hall, Jr., G
Catalon scored 20 points in the 90-83 double-overtime win over Fordham, with 15 of her 20 points coming in the fourth quarter. In the second overtime, she hit a go-ahead three-pointer with 2:06 left to play. Catalon also tied for the team lead with eight rebounds, to go with three assists and three steals.
Ryanne Allen, Villanova, Sr., G
Allen recorded team-highs in points (19) and assists (6) in Villanova's 88-58 win versus Temple. She went 7-for-8 from the field, including 5-for-6 from deep.
Mariyah Noel, Xavier, Jr., G
Noel posted her second double-double of the season with 19 points and a career-high 11 rebounds in the 74-53 win vs. Ohio. The guard was 6-for-12 from the floor and 6-for-7 from the free throw line, adding five assists.
